NDG wrote:Question is with TD force winds and a pressure of only 1015mb found so far, will they upgrage it to a TD?


Yep, as long as recon confirms a closed low then the NHC would find it very hard not to upgrade given the Vis presentation right now.

Their main fear probably is the convection going poof, and I'm sure if this was in the E.Atlantic they would not bother until it had held for a longer period of time, but being where it is and with recon in there, going to be hard for NHC not to upgrade if the LLC is found.
